    Term Life Insurance

    As the name suggests, term life insurance provides coverage for a certain period of time, as specified in your policy. This means that a death benefit will only be paid out if you die within your policy’s term. Because of this central characteristic, term life insurance policies tend to be much cheaper than permanent life insurance policies—making it a very appealing option to young adults or families who can’t spend a lot on life insurance.

    ms—level term (pays the same death benefit no matter when you die during the term) and decreasing term (the death benefit decreases throughout the duration of the policy)—level term policies are by far the most popular.

    According to the Insurance Information Institute (I.I.I.) common types of level term policies are:

    • Annual (least popular)
    • 5 year
    • 10 year
    • 15 year
    • 20 year (most popular)
    • 25 year
    • 30 year
    Many term life insurance policies are renewable, which means that you may be able to reinstate your policy after the term ends, although reinstatement may be contingent on passing a medical exam and will likely involve an increased premium. Additionally, the I.I.I. reports that most insurers will not renew a policy ending after 80 years of age.
